Geva Theatre Center is at 75 Woodbury Boulevard, Rochester, NY.
As a not-for-profit organization with an annual operating budget of approximately $7.0 million, Geva employs approximately 200 people throughout the season and has an estimated overall economic impact on Rochester of more than $10 million. Geva has generated over $200 million in economic activity in the community since the organization was founded in 1972. Since its inception, over 5,636 actors, directors, musical directors, designers and stage managers have worked at Geva.
